Cars Tech Help

Need help on how to install those new subframe connectors? Need to know what on earth that means? Check it out, right here, right now.
I
Replies
0
Views
92
I am ready
I
S
Replies
0
Views
80
Stacie P
S
T
Replies
0
Views
148
tudor_t_best
T
K
Replies
0
Views
85
kbush05
K
M
Replies
0
Views
162
mcbuddah96
M
M
Replies
0
Views
106
mohamed_mahfouz111
M
Back
Top